In India, a festival is never just a date on the calendar; it’s a lifestyle event.

Simultaneously, the preparation of morning chai (tea) or filter coffee is treated with absolute seriousness. Chai is not just a beverage; it is a daily social requirement. Brewed with fresh ginger, cardamom, and plenty of milk, it serves as the catalyst for family members to gather around the dining table or balcony to read the morning newspaper and discuss local news. By 7:00 PM, the focus shifts indoors to the "homework hustle." Education is highly prioritized in Indian culture, and evenings are dominated by school projects, math tuition, and exam preparation. Parents take an active role, sitting with children at the dining table to review notebooks, ensuring that academic expectations are met. Modernization and urbanization have brought significant changes to Indian family lifestyles. Many young Indians are moving to cities for education and employment, leading to a shift away from traditional occupations and joint family setups.
